From 1bee36d9b6a1d9c6eccbeb2a824e03cd2628bd8b Mon Sep 17 00:00:00 2001 From: Karel Balej Date: Tue, 14 Jan 2025 21:00:33 +0100 Subject: [PATCH] =?UTF-8?q?personalni:=20p=C5=99ejmenov=C3=A1n=C3=AD=20slo?= =?UTF-8?q?upce=20pro=20upozorn=C4=9Bn=C3=AD=20na=20zp=C4=9Btnou=20vazbu?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- odevzdavatko/views.py | 2 +- personalni/forms.py | 2 +- ...eni_resitel_upozornovat_na_opravy_reseni.py | 18 ++++++++++++++++++ personalni/models.py | 2 +- .../templates/personalni/udaje/udaje.html | 2 +- personalni/views.py | 2 +- 6 files changed, 23 insertions(+), 5 deletions(-) create mode 100644 personalni/migrations/0019_rename_upozorneni_resitel_upozornovat_na_opravy_reseni.py diff --git a/odevzdavatko/views.py b/odevzdavatko/views.py index b5c3d54d..255f48a9 100644 --- a/odevzdavatko/views.py +++ b/odevzdavatko/views.py @@ -332,7 +332,7 @@ def hodnoceniReseniView(request, pk, *args, **kwargs): hodnoceni.body = -0.1 hodnoceni.save() - adresati = reseni.resitele.filter(upozorneni=True).values_list('osoba__email', flat=True) + adresati = reseni.resitele.filter(upozornovat_na_opravy_reseni=True).values_list('osoba__email', flat=True) if notifikace and adresati: email = EmailMessage( subject='Změna hodnocení odevzdaného řešení', diff --git a/personalni/forms.py b/personalni/forms.py index 2f6c79c8..39e1b6ab 100644 --- a/personalni/forms.py +++ b/personalni/forms.py @@ -71,7 +71,7 @@ class UdajeForm(forms.Form): zasilat_cislo_emailem = forms.BooleanField(label='Chci dostávat e-mailem upozornění na vydání nového čísla', required=False, initial=True) spam = forms.BooleanField(label='Souhlasím se zasíláním propagačních materiálů od MFF UK', required=False) - upozorneni = forms.BooleanField(label='Chci dostávat emailová upozornění na změnu zpětné vazby k mým řešením', required=False, initial=True) + upozornovat_na_opravy_reseni = forms.BooleanField(label='Chci dostávat emailová upozornění na změnu zpětné vazby k mým řešením', required=False, initial=True) def clean_prezdivka_resitele(self): prezdivka_resitele = self.cleaned_data.get('prezdivka_resitele') diff --git a/personalni/migrations/0019_rename_upozorneni_resitel_upozornovat_na_opravy_reseni.py b/personalni/migrations/0019_rename_upozorneni_resitel_upozornovat_na_opravy_reseni.py new file mode 100644 index 00000000..e5a4caaf --- /dev/null +++ b/personalni/migrations/0019_rename_upozorneni_resitel_upozornovat_na_opravy_reseni.py @@ -0,0 +1,18 @@ +# Generated by Django 4.2.18 on 2025-01-14 19:48 + +from django.db import migrations + + +class Migration(migrations.Migration): + + dependencies = [ + ('personalni', '0018_resitel_upozorneni'), + ] + + operations = [ + migrations.RenameField( + model_name='resitel', + old_name='upozorneni', + new_name='upozornovat_na_opravy_reseni', + ), + ] diff --git a/personalni/models.py b/personalni/models.py index 930716a7..e04aca0b 100644 --- a/personalni/models.py +++ b/personalni/models.py @@ -250,7 +250,7 @@ class Resitel(SeminarModelBase): poznamka = models.TextField('neveřejná poznámka', blank=True, help_text='Neveřejná poznámka k řešiteli (plain text)') - upozorneni = models.BooleanField('zasílat upozornění na změnu zpětné vazby k řešení emailem', default=True) + upozornovat_na_opravy_reseni = models.BooleanField('zasílat upozornění na změnu zpětné vazby k řešení emailem', default=True) def export_row(self): diff --git a/personalni/templates/personalni/udaje/udaje.html b/personalni/templates/personalni/udaje/udaje.html index 5ed30b74..83bce161 100644 --- a/personalni/templates/personalni/udaje/udaje.html +++ b/personalni/templates/personalni/udaje/udaje.html @@ -51,7 +51,7 @@ {% include "personalni/udaje/prihlaska_field.html" with field=form.zasilat_cislo_emailem %} - {% include "personalni/udaje/prihlaska_field.html" with field=form.upozorneni %} + {% include "personalni/udaje/prihlaska_field.html" with field=form.upozornovat_na_opravy_reseni %} {% include "personalni/udaje/prihlaska_field.html" with field=form.zasilat_cislo_papirove %} {% include "personalni/udaje/prihlaska_field.html" with field=form.spam %} {% include "personalni/udaje/prihlaska_field.html" with field=form.zasilat %} diff --git a/personalni/views.py b/personalni/views.py index 38f9bc57..c71ce418 100644 --- a/personalni/views.py +++ b/personalni/views.py @@ -230,7 +230,7 @@ def resitelEditView(request): resitel_edit.zasilat = fcd['zasilat'] resitel_edit.zasilat_cislo_emailem = fcd['zasilat_cislo_emailem'] resitel_edit.zasilat_cislo_papirove = fcd['zasilat_cislo_papirove'] - resitel_edit.upozorneni = fcd['upozorneni'] + resitel_edit.upozornovat_na_opravy_reseni = fcd['upozornovat_na_opravy_reseni'] if fcd.get('skola'): resitel_edit.skola = fcd['skola'] else: